America is a beautiful place with many different regions that offer distinct sights, experiences, and lifestyles. The regions of the United States and their unique physical geography have shaped the culture, customs, and way of life of the people living there. Strong Native American and Mexican influences in the American Southwest can be seen in the region's art, architecture, clothing styles, and foods. Similarly the physical geography of the Midwest has helped cultivate a culture known for agriculture and manufacturing.
